With chocolate sabayon (like a chocolate souffle) at Corduroy Restaurant, DC.
The port was about midway between ruby and amber in color. Fragrant nose--prune and ?
Lots of rich prune on the palate. A bit of apricot discernible in the mid-palate. Forms legs on the glass. Velvety smooth--no burn from the alcohol. I can see why Bucko and others like Niepoort. The chocolate sabayon (rich dark, semisweet chocolate) was served with hazelnut ice cream and hazelnut tuile.
